Output 3cac8f5855538b8ef32f194005f4c6db4bf12a3cabb66ec251cabbbc897943d0:3

value
18709843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 896ab68a61b995716eeba5ab2fd1266ff1ac32aa OP_EQUAL
address
MLRkeGExw8dd3WWbFTfF6PjxEVquSJahkR
transaction
3cac8f5855538b8ef32f194005f4c6db4bf12a3cabb66ec251cabbbc897943d0
spent
true